Silence - the bitter pill. Most poets, writers, musicians, painters etc have to figure out a way to deal with it. Some succumb to its perceived and mostly fraudulent message that what they have to offer is not worth much. Others use a form of CBT reminding themselves that people's lives are being enriched by what they have to offer but for some reason are unable to respond - not realising the importance of feedback. But I like your way the best Andy. Do for others what you would like to have done for you. I think it's called 'the Golden Rule'.
